Now a days, in many industries different types of controllers (PD,PID,PLC,FLC etc.) are used. One of them is fuzzy logic controller. Here we develop fuzzy logic controller for industrial application, such application for temperature control of any electrical machine. For developing FLC, first we have to design fuzzy logic controller. Identify the variables of any electrical machine or plant. Partition the universe of discourse or the interval of each variable into a number of fuzzy subsets, assigning each a linguistic label. Assign or determine a membership function for each fuzzy subset. Assign the fuzzy relationships between the inputs or states fuzzy subsets on the one hand the outputs fuzzy subsets on the other hand, thus forming the rule-base. Choose appropriate scaling factors for the input and output variables in order to normalize the variables to the [0,l] or the [-1,1] interval. Fuzzily two inputs to the controllers. Use Fuzzy approximate reasoning to inter the output variables in order to normalize the variables to [0,1] or the [-1,1] interval. Aggregate the fuzzy outputs recommended by each rule. Apply Defuzzification to form a crisp output. The ouput of fuzzy logic controller gives to tee any electrical machine which have certain parameters. Also connect some parameter like signal builder, scope etc. in matlab software. After the connection of all inputs. Run the program and we obtain the output. We can see the result both in scope and rule viewer.
